Understanding the Core Mechanics of the Game
At its heart, a typical mines game presents a grid of squares, each concealing either a prize or a mine. The player’s objective is to reveal as many prizes as possible without detonating a mine. Each correct choice increases the potential reward, often compounding with each successful turn. This escalating reward structure adds a layer of excitement and encourages players to push their luck, testing the boundaries of their risk tolerance. The game isn't purely about luck, however; astute players can often discern patterns or utilize strategies to improve their odds. Observing previous results, understanding probability, and developing a personal risk assessment system are all key elements to successful gameplay.

The Psychological Appeal of Risk-Reward Systems
The popularity of mines games isn't solely based on their gameplay mechanics; it’s also deeply rooted in the psychological principles of risk and reward. The thrill of potentially winning big, combined with the anxiety of avoiding a catastrophic loss, triggers a unique neurochemical response in the brain. The anticipation of a positive outcome releases dopamine, a neurotransmitter associated with pleasure and motivation, while the fear of failure activates the amygdala, the brain's fear center. This interplay of emotions creates a highly engaging and addictive experience. The escalating reward structure further reinforces this cycle, incentivizing players to continue taking risks in pursuit of larger prizes.
The Role of Near Misses and Variable Reinforcement
The psychological impact of these games is also heightened by the phenomenon of “near misses” – situations where a player narrowly avoids triggering a mine. These near misses are interpreted by the brain as a close call rather than a failure, and they can actually increase the desire to continue playing. This is because they provide a sense of control and reinforce the belief that success is within reach. Furthermore, the variable reinforcement schedule – where rewards are not predictable – makes the game even more compelling. Unpredictability keeps players engaged and prevents them from becoming bored or complacent. This parallels the principles behind slot machines and other forms of gambling, which are designed to exploit our natural inclination towards chasing rewards.
